Expert Warns of Impending 2025 Stock Market Crash: What Investors Need to Know
Marko Kolanovic, an eminent financial analyst affectionately nicknamed the "Gandalf" of Wall Street, has sounded the alarm for another stock market crash, due to hit by 2025. This latest prediction follows his earlier successful forecasts of sell-offs in 2015, 2018, and the COVID-19 recovery.
Kolanovic: A crash to 5,000 and potentially 4,000 points on the S&P500
Citing global geopolitical tensions, overvalued technology stocks, and an ailing economy, Kolanovic warned of a possible return to the S&P500's 5,000 level this year, with a worst-case scenario of a drop to 4,000 points—equating to a 33% market downturn.

Additional investment considerations
While Kolanovic hasn't explicitly spelled out his investment strategy for fortifying portfolios against the looming market downturn, his past market views and strategies can give us a clue. Investors may wish to consider the following general risk-mitigation strategies:
- Diversify Investments: Balance portfolio holdings across various asset classes to reduce exposure to any one market sector.
- Invest in Defensive Stocks: Allocate funds towards sectors less affected by economic downturns, such as healthcare, consumer staples, and utilities.
- Maintain Liquidity: Keep cash reserves on hand and consider investing in high-quality bonds for stability during volatile periods.
- Risk Management Tools: Utilize options or futures contracts to hedge against potential losses, for instance, by buying put options to guard against stock price declines.
- Monitor Market Conditions: Regularly assess market trends and adjust strategies according to the prevailing conditions. Beware of market timing's inherent risks.
- Avoid Speculative Assets: Be cautious with investments in volatility-prone assets, such as cryptocurrencies, during uncertain times.
As always, financial advisors should be consulted, and thorough research conducted before making any investment decisions.
